90 Credit Level 3 Diploma Health and Social Care (Adults)

UPDATED 20170131 10:50:35

This course is designed for adult students who are wanting to pursue a career or further study in the area of health or social care. The course enables you to gain essential skills and knowledge through both college sessions and experience in the workplace. Topics studied on the course include: . Communication skills . Lifespan development . Equality and diversity . Anatomy and physiology . Psychology . Sociology . Public health . Caring for children . Safeguarding vulnerable adults All students attending work experience placements will need to obtain DBS clearance before starting. The cost for this check is GBT50.50.
